Compiling Mini-XML

Mini-XML comes with an autoconf-based configure script; just type the following command to get things going:

    ./configure ENTER

The default install prefix is /usr/local, which can be overridden using the --prefix option:

    ./configure --prefix=/foo ENTER

Other configure options can be found using the --help option:

    ./configure --help ENTER

Once you have configured the software, use the make(1) program to do the build and run the test program to verify that things are working, as follows:

    make ENTER
